# #81dcdf

A color — cool, modern. Deterministic analysis from BrandSweets (no inference).

## Values

- Hex: `#81dcdf`
- RGB: rgb(129, 220, 223)
- HSL: hsl(182, 59%, 69%)
- OKLCH: oklch(0.839 0.087 198.4)
- Relative luminance: 0.6118
- Nearest named color: Cold Blue (#88dddd, Δ 0.786) — https://brandsweets.com/colors/cold-blue
- Moods: cool, modern

##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 1.59:1 — AA fail, AA-large fail,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#238286 (4.56:1); AA: background → #575757 (4.55:1); AAA: text → #195f61 (7.37:1); AAA: background → #3b3b3b (7.06:1)
- On black (#000000): 13.24: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A pass
